Transaction 08cf75469fd1237b407aecd38d8c58e66b0133ba3f8acd4c28630679c0ccc410

1 Input
1 Outputs
  • 08cf75469fd1237b407aecd38d8c58e66b0133ba3f8acd4c28630679c0ccc410:0
  • value  9337963
    address  37d9LRsdTWVehVU8a1Ru94vwvERPMi7Bz6